Claire Goldsmith is the great granddaughter of Oliver Goldsmith, founder of the eyewear brand that carries his name. She is tapping into the retro-cool mood with the re-release of top 1960s designs (right: The Timothy, pounds 250; left: The Goo Goo, pounds 230; tel 020 7221 0255). Spectacular.
